Hi Nick, it must be said that your rant does not help at all to answer the original support question. Hi Rijul, please check that your downloaded image is not corrupted. You can download and compare it with our copy which we have used successfully an uncounted number of times: http://download.goldelico.com/gta02/Moko11/ You must also flash the image on the flat memory card (e.g. /dev/sdb) and not into a partition (and not /dev/sdb1 or /dev/sdb2). To boot from NOR flash, press the AUX button and then power on. The boot menu should appear within a second. Choose boot from SD (ext). Failure? Not at all. Openmoko, the project, helped to spin a lot of important movements throughout the industry, and, even more important, Openmoko Inc., the company, brought the first truly hackable mobile phone hardware into the hands of 'everyone'. That's a major achievement and I even go so far to say it's undisputable. Yes, the hardware was not perfect, and yes, due to a bunch of management failures combined with the economic crisis a couple of years ago, there is no more mobile phone hardware coming from Openmoko Inc. To say that Openmoko, the project, has no future is far from the truth and we can see that every day watching the action happening on free hard- and software projects all around the globe, such as GTA04, FSO, SHR, QtMoko. Yes, much of the action has moved from the Openmoko devices to newer devices, such as the HTC phones, Palm Pre, Nokia N900, etc., but again, hardware ages, that's a given, and by no means a fault of Openmoko Inc., the company.
